You Know When Your UI Needs Help When…

Seen at a gas station:

IMG_0220

You know your UI has usability issues when people tape multiple signs on your gas pump to help people get through the intricate and error-prone process of purchasing fuel.

Why does the upper note exist? The trouble is that there’s a Debit button but not a Credit button, and so since Credit is the default, users need to remember to override the default before swiping the card. People will sometimes naturally forget the special step because there was originally no reminder that this needed to be done, and because most other pumps don’t work that way. One solution would be to print the information prominently near the card reader, thus standardizing the note and making it more visible. A better and simpler solution would be to do what most pumps do: Avoid the opportunity for forgetting to specify the right thing by having both buttons, Debit and Credit, and simply prompting the user to press one or the other after they swipe their card.

But the trouble behind the lower note is even more blatant and, frankly, inexcusable: Is there any good reason not to conditionally print “ENTER PIN” or “ENTER ZIP,” instead of just always printing “ENTER DATA” which is not only unclear but also one of the classic geeky words to avoid in a consumer-oriented UI?

Then again, I’m amazed that in this day and age I still see output like “1 item(s) purchased.” Apparently it’s still more important to write the programmer-friendly printf( “%d item(s)”, count ) than the user-friendly printf( “%d item%s”, count, (count==1 ? “” : “s”) ).

Effective Concurrency: Use Thread Pools Correctly – Keep Tasks Short and Nonblocking

This month’s Effective Concurrency column, “Use Thread Pools Correctly: Keep Tasks Short and Nonblocking”, is now live on DDJ’s website.

From the article:

… But the thread pool is a leaky abstraction. That is, the pool hides a lot of details from us, but to use it effectively we do need to be aware of some things a pool does under the covers so that we can avoid inadvertently hitting performance and correctness pitfalls. Here’s the summary up front:

1. Tasks should be small, but not too small, otherwise performance overheads will dominate.

2. Tasks should avoid blocking (waiting idly for other events, including inbound messages or contested locks), otherwise the pool won’t consistently utilize the hardware well — and, in the extreme worst case, the pool could even deadlock.

Let’s see why. …

RIP: SD Conferences

The latest casualties in the technical education world are the Software Development conferences – SD West, SD Best Practices, and Architecture & Design World – which are being discontinued effective immediately, making the SD West that was just held earlier this month the last of its kind. The conferences were run by the same company that ran some important but now-defunct magazines including C/C++ Users Journal and of course Software Development Magazine, as well as Dr. Dobb’s which still exists but recently went web-only.

SD, especially SD West, has been a mainstay of the programming conferences world since 1985. I’m going to miss these shows. They were a wonderful gathering place for talks and tutorials by A-list speakers covering many technologies, from C++ to Java to AJAX and more. More personally, Bjarne Stroustrup and I immensely enjoyed giving our two-day Stroustrup & Sutter seminar there several times in recent years, and skipped this year’s event in anticipation of doing a fresh one again next spring. Alas, it’s not to be (at least not with SD).

SD, you will be missed.

Effective Concurrency: Sharing Is the Root of All Contention

This month’s Effective Concurrency column, “Sharing Is the Root of All Contention”, is now live on DDJ’s website.

This article aims to address the root cause behind some frequently made assertions: Statements like “locks kill scalability” and “CAS kills scalability” are mostly true but focus on symptoms rather than causes; and others such as “reader/writer mutexes are great for scalability” at minimum need some heavy qualification.

From the article:

Quick: What fundamental principle do all of the following have in common?

  • Two children drawing with crayons.
  • Three customers at Starbucks adding cream to their coffee.
  • Four processes running on a CPU core.
  • Five threads updating an object protected by a mutex.
  • Six threads running on different processors updating the same lock-free queue.
  • Seven modules using the same reference-counted shared object.

Answer: In each case, multiple users share a resource that requires coordination because not everyone can use it simultaneously — and such sharing is the root cause of all resulting contention that will degrade everyone’s performance. (Note: The only kind of shared resource that doesn’t create contention is one that inherently requires no synchronization because all users can use it simultaneously without restriction, which means it doesn’t fall into the description above. For example, an immutable object can have its unchanging bits be read by any number of threads or processors at any time without synchronization.)

In this article, I’ll deliberately focus most of the examples on one important case, namely mutable (writable) shared objects in memory, which are an inherent bottleneck to scalability on multicore systems. But please don’t lose sight of the key point, namely that "sharing causes contention" is a general principle that is not limited to shared memory or even to computing.

The Inherent Costs of Sharing

Here’s the issue in one sentence: Sharing fundamentally requires waiting and demands answers to expensive questions. …

Aside: This will be in the first electronic-only Dr. Dobb’s Report, and I’m going to have to get used to Dobb’s being electronic-only. One consequence of this change that I just discovered today is that an article can go online hours after I correct the proofs. That may seem like it shouldn’t be surprising in the days of blogs, but a magazine isn’t (or at least wasn’t) like a blog. When I wrote for magazines like C++ Report in the late 1990s, the time between submitting the final column manuscript and seeing it in print was about two to three months, depending on the magazine. Since the mid-2000s with Dobb’s, it’s been only one month from proofs to print — and Dobb’s could have posted the online versions even sooner, but held them back to be semi-synced with the print magazine. Now that the print constraint has disappeared, apparently I can (and, today, did) start work on a Friday morning to find the Dobb’s proofs I corrected the night before already on the web. Nifty. Income in Perspective: 2 Bppl @ $3/day

I just saw a CNN headline that read: “Young workers scrimp to live on $15/wk.” Before reading further, what do you think: Is that stunning and shocking? Or shockingly typical?

The story turned out to be a piece about white-collar workers in China trying to live frugally, spending only 100 Yuan on travel and food during the workweek to conserve funds. Of course, the workers’ actual total expenses and income are higher, because that $15/week figure doesn’t include weekend expenses and other major costs like rent. Even so, the story is considered newsworthy here, and is probably a shock to a number of readers in the western world.

But the headline wouldn’t surprise readers who are familiar with the approximate distribution of income/GDP/wealth in the world.

To illustrate, here are two personal data points from 2006, when my wife and I traveled to Kenya and Zambia to visit friends:

  • Income: In Kenya, we were told that being a staff worker at a safari lodge is considered a good job. What does it pay? About $2 per day, for long hours and six-day weeks. This isn’t unusual; in about 30 countries, including Kenya, more than half of the population earns under $2 per day. An estimated two billion people – 30% of the world’s population – live on an income of less than $3 per day. And $3 per day is about what the attention-grabbing CNN headline implies, though the actual story behind that headline is much less bad.
  • Cost of living: But what happens when we consider, not just dollar-for-dollar comparisons, but purchasing power? Isn’t it less expensive to live in less-developed countries? Yes, it usually is, especially for shelter and services – there’s been some talk lately on the U.S. news about retiring in Mexico as a way for older people to save money in this economy – but the difference for the same quality goods is often less than one might think. In Lusaka, the capital of Zambia, we found there were only three grocery stores [*] having similar goods to what we would expect to find in a U.S.-style Safeway, although of course the Zambian stores were much smaller than U.S. stores (more the size of a medium Trader Joe’s) and offered far less selection diversity (something like a factor of 20 fewer varieties or brands). When we visited one of the stores, I picked up a few Western-style items, totaled the price and converted to U.S. dollars in my head, and found that those comparable products in Lusaka cost nearly the same as we would have paid for the same items in Seattle. Our local friend replied: “Right, nobody who lives here would ever think of buying a can of soda pop.” Certainly not when a can of Coke costs a day’s wage for many people, and doesn’t confer any significant nutritional benefit.

The gulf between the western- and world-median standards of living is, simply put, vast – and growing. The standard of living that’s normal for most of the planet’s population is well nigh unimaginable to many of us in the western world, and even for those of us who’ve been there, it’s one thing to see it and quite another to really understand what such a life would be like. I don’t claim to.
